Accelerated Bachelor of Science in Nursing - ABSN

Our mission-minded accelerated nursing program works to advance health equity and social justice through an innovative educational experience. You’ll collaborate with expert faculty, utilize high-fidelity simulation labs, experience diverse local and global clinical placements, and participate in shaping the future of health care.

Master of Nursing Degree - MN

Our MEPN program builds upon your previous academic and professional experiences while preparing you to transition into the nursing profession. Upon earning your Master of Nursing degree, you will be eligible to take the RN licensing exam (NCLEX-RN©) and begin your nursing practice.
